安装MySQL必备命令指南
安装mysql执行什么命令

首页 2025-07-21 12:14:27



安装MySQL:一步步执行高效命令,构建强大的数据库环境 在当今的数据驱动世界中,MySQL作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性和易用性,成为了众多开发者和企业的首选

    无论是用于构建复杂的企业级应用,还是简单的个人项目,MySQL都能提供强有力的支持

    然而,要充分利用MySQL的强大功能,首先需要正确安装它

    本文将详细指导你如何通过一系列高效命令,在主流操作系统上安装MySQL,确保你能迅速搭建起一个稳定、高效的数据库环境

     一、准备工作:了解你的操作系统 在安装MySQL之前,首先需要明确你正在使用的操作系统

    MySQL支持多种操作系统,包括Windows、Linux(如Ubuntu、CentOS)以及macOS

    不同操作系统下的安装步骤和命令会有所不同

    因此,确保你已经知道了自己的操作系统类型和版本,这将直接影响后续的安装步骤

     二、在Windows上安装MySQL 对于Windows用户来说,安装MySQL通常涉及下载MySQL Installer进行图形化安装,但也可以通过命令行方式安装MySQL Server

    以下是使用MySQL Installer的简化步骤及命令提示: 1.下载MySQL Installer:访问MySQL官方网站,下载适用于你Windows版本的MySQL Installer

     2.运行Installer:双击下载的exe文件,启动MySQL Installer

    在界面中选择“Developer Default”或“Server only”安装选项,根据需求选择MySQL Server、Workbench等工具

     3.配置MySQL Server:安装过程中,Installer会引导你完成MySQL Server的配置,包括设置root密码、选择默认字符集等

    虽然这是图形界面操作,但背后实际上是通过一系列预定义的命令行脚本完成的

     4.验证安装:安装完成后,可以通过命令提示符(CMD)验证MySQL是否安装成功

    打开CMD,输入`mysql -u root -p`,然后输入你在安装过程中设置的root密码

    如果成功连接到MySQL服务器,说明安装无误

     虽然Windows上主要通过图形界面安装,但了解背后的命令行逻辑对于后续维护和故障排查至关重要

     三、在Ubuntu上安装MySQL 对于Linux用户,特别是Ubuntu用户,安装MySQL变得尤为简单,因为Ubuntu官方仓库已经包含了MySQL的包

    以下是详细步骤: 1.更新包列表: bash sudo apt update 这条命令确保你的本地包索引是最新的,以便安装最新版本的软件

     2.安装MySQL Server: bash sudo apt install mysql-server 此命令会从Ubuntu的官方仓库下载并安装MySQL Server及其依赖项

    安装过程中,系统会提示你设置root密码,请务必设置一个强密码以确保数据库安全

     3.启动MySQL服务: bash sudo systemctl start mysql 安装完成后,需要手动启动MySQL服务

    为了使MySQL在系统启动时自动运行,可以使用`sudo systemctl enable mysql`命令

     4.验证安装: 与Windows类似,你可以通过以下命令验证MySQL是否安装成功: bash sudo mysql -u root -p 输入设置的root密码后,如果成功登录到MySQL命令行界面,说明安装和配置正确

     5.安全配置: 安装完成后,运行`sudo mysql_secure_installation`命令,根据提示进行一系列安全设置,如删除匿名用户、禁止root远程登录、删除测试数据库等,以增强数据库安全性

     四、在CentOS上安装MySQL CentOS作为另一种流行的Linux发行版,其安装MySQL的过程与Ubuntu略有不同,主要因为CentOS默认使用yum或dnf作为包管理器,而不是apt

     1.添加MySQL Yum Repository: 由于CentOS的官方仓库中可能不包含最新版本的MySQL,因此通常需要从MySQL官方网站下载并添加MySQL Yum Repository

     bash sudo yum localinstall https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pm 注意:URL可能会根据MySQL的最新版本有所变化,请访问MySQL官网获取最新链接

     2.安装MySQL Server: bash sudo yum install mysql-community-server 3.启动MySQL服务: bash sudo systemctl start mysqld 同样,使用`sudo systemctl enable mysqld`命令设置MySQL服务开机自启

     4.获取临时root密码: CentOS安装MySQL后,会在`/var/log/mysqld.log`文件中生成一个临时root密码

    使用以下命令查找: bash sudo grep temporary password /var/log/mysqld.log 5.安全配置与验证: 使用找到的临时密码登录MySQL,然后立即运行`ALTER USER root@localhost IDENTIFIED BY NewPassword;`更改密码

    之后,执行`sudo mysql_secure_installation`进行安全配置,步骤与Ubuntu类似

     五、在macOS上安装MySQL macOS用户可以通过Homebrew这一流行的包管理器来安装MySQL

     1.安装Homebrew(如果尚未安装): bash /bin/bash -c$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h) 2.安装MySQL: bash brew install mysql 3.启动MySQL服务: bash brew services start mysql 4.安全配置与验证: macOS上的MySQL安装和配置过程与Linux类似,包括设置root密码、运行`mysql_secure_installation`等

     六、总结 无论你是在Windows、Ubuntu、

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道